SunbirtFX: General Overview

Founded in 2005, Sunbirdfx is a foreign exchange and CFD broker. SunbirdFX claims that its customers can choose various account types, all of which provide an NDD environment, micro-tradable lots, variable spreads, and leverage up to 1:300. They claim to offer Escrow accounts and Islamic (no credit card) accounts too.

However, even though all these offers look attractive, we don’t recommend you invest your funds with them, as the broker is unregulated. They are registered in an offshore zone in the Commonwealth of Dominica.

Moreover, the sunbirdfx.com website fails to proceed, making it practically impossible to get full access and information about their services. Now, let’s continue with a more specific analysis.

Safety concerns with SunbirdFX

Although SunbirdFX was previously pointed out to be regulated by the International Financial Market Relations Regulatory Center (IFMRRC), the broker does not seem to be regulated by any financial institution at this stage.

They are registered in an offshore zone, which means no one takes responsibility for their financial activities.

Besides, there is no information on whether the broker opens separate bank accounts for the clients’ funds or not, so there is no guarantee the company will protect your personal and financial data.

Trading conditions with SunbirdFX

Speaking of trading conditions, SunbirdFX offers MetaTrader 4 as their default trading software. However, as the website is practically inaccessible, we can not guarantee they provide accurate MT4 or fake.

As mentioned above, SunbirdFX customers can choose various account types, providing NDD environment, micro-tradable lots, variable spreads, and leverage up to 1:300.

Although the minimum initial deposit of 100 USD is reasonable, the average spread of SunbirdFX on standard accounts is higher than the average range of 1.0 – 1.5 points for EUR/USD. The transaction cost of the Pro (ECN) account is low. However, we do not recommend investing USD 5,000 in this broker because it is registered overseas.

Deposits and Withdrawals

Traders can proceed both deposits and withdrawals with SunbirdFX using several popular methods: CashU, Credit/Debit Cards, Neteller, WebMoney, and Bank Wire Transfer.

Brokers also did not specify whether they charge additional fees for deposits or withdrawals. So, it is an essential factor affecting trading profitability.

Many brokers do not charge additional withdrawal fees.

As with all brokers, the processing time for deposits and withdrawals will depend on the selected payment method.

In addition, traders should pay attention to prohibiting third-party deposits and withdrawals. During withdrawals, traders must use the same method they used to provide funds for the corresponding trading account.

Finally, SunbirdFX also did not specify the deposit currency accepted for funding the trader’s account.

When conducting Forex transactions, it is usually best to choose multiple deposit currencies. Having to withdraw funds from a currency other than the base currency will increase the cost of affecting your profitability, usually by paying a conversion fee.

These conversion fees may occur during the transaction and when withdrawing funds from your trading account.
